    There are four prime numbers written in ascending order. The product of first three is 385 and that of the last three is 1001. The first number is 

    A) 5

    B)  7          

    C)  11

    D)  17   

    Correct Answer: A

    Solution :

    Let the given prime numbers be a, b, c d. Then, \[\frac{abc}{bcd}=\frac{385}{1001}=\frac{5}{13}\]\[\Rightarrow \]\[\frac{a}{d}=\frac{5}{13}\]\[\Rightarrow \]\[a=5\]and \[d=13\] In given prime numbers, the first one is 5.
